Patio Brick Installation in Boston, MA
Patio brick installation services involve the placement of durable, attractive bricks to create functional outdoor living spaces. This service covers a variety of projects, including new patio construction, repair of existing brick surfaces, and the addition of decorative brick features such as borders or pathways. Homeowners typically want to understand the different styles and materials available, as well as how the installation process will enhance the property's curb appeal and usability.
Before requesting patio brick installation, property owners should consider factors such as the size and layout of the desired space, the type of bricks best suited for their climate and aesthetic preferences, and any necessary groundwork or preparation. Understanding the maintenance requirements and longevity of different brick options can also help in making informed decisions that align with the property's overall design and functional needs.

Patio Brick Installation Questions
What types of bricks are commonly used for patios? Common options include clay, concrete, and natural stone bricks, each offering different styles and durability levels for outdoor spaces.
Can brick patios be installed over existing surfaces? Yes, brick patios can often be installed over existing concrete or paving surfaces with proper preparation and leveling.
What is the typical lifespan of a brick patio? With proper maintenance, a brick patio can last 25 years or more, maintaining its appearance and functionality over time.
Are there design options available for brick patios? Yes, brick patios can be arranged in various patterns and colors to complement different landscape styles and property aesthetics.
